Hi Fabio,
> Hi Lukasz,
>
> On Thu, Aug 15, 2024 at 5:14 PM Lukasz Majewski <lukma@denx.de> wrote:
>
> > Unfortunately not - this change is only for properly setting start
> > address of the u-boot.
> >
> > The _real_ problem here is the symbol placement generated by binman
> > when we try to define the image as a single one.
> >
> > Moreover, this change follows other boards with imx8mm processor -
> > ./configs/imx8mm_beacon_fspi_defconfig to be specific.
> >
> > The "fix" (for which I'd been now probably opt) for this issue
> > would be to generate two images with binman - one for
> > u-boot-spl-ddr.bin and the final flash.bin with the former one
> > included (as it was before SHA1:
> > 37e50627efacd8dae18b564e9d8886a033e181bc)
>
> Is QSPI boot broken on i.MX8MM?
>
With newest mainline - yes.
Please consult (this works on polis):
https://github.com/lmajewski/u-boot/commits/phycore-imx8mm-qspi-nvme
The spl symbols after binman generation are off by 0x1000 (by the
inserted on the beginning QSPI header)
> I am adding Adam and Mamta who have tested QSPI booting on
> imx8mm_beacon and imx8mm_evk, respectively.
Ok. Good.
